How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Greensboro?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Greensboro Studio Apartments | $1,015 | $525 | $2,339 |
| Greensboro 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,310 | $725 | $2,199 |
| Greensboro 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,499 | $614 | $3,472 |
| Greensboro 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,862 | $639 | $4,000 |
| Greensboro 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,937 | $539 | $3,912 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Greensboro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Greensboro with 3 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Greensboro is at The Pointe at White Oak listed at $1,099.
How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Greensboro Apartment?
The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Greensboro is $1,862.
What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Greensboro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Greensboro is a 1,779 square feet unit starting from $2,815 at HARMON Jefferson Village by Crescent Communities.
What is the average size for Greensboro 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Greensboro is currently 1,545 sq ft.
